What Problems Occur From Poor Airflow in Dryer Vents?
Blocked dryer ducts can create multiple problems for both airflow and safety:
- Reduced dryer efficiency: Clothes take longer to dry, even after multiple cycles.
- Overheating machines: A clogged exhaust or trap can cause dryers to overheat and damage internal parts.
- High energy costs: A dryer running longer consumes more power, increasing household bills.
- Mold or mildew growth: Moisture buildup inside ducts and laundry rooms due to poor ventilation.
- Potential fire hazards: Lint buildup inside ducts and near the roof exhaust is highly flammable.

What Is the Cost of Dryer Vent Cleaning in St. Louis?
The cost of professional services in St. Louis, MO, depends on the company, the complexity of ductwork, and whether additional cleaning or repair is needed. Below is an estimated cost guide:
Service Type | Average Cost (USD) |
---|---|
Basic Dryer Vent Cleaning | $90 – $150 |
Full HVAC & Dryer Vent Package | $200 – $400 |
Roof Vent or Chimney Exhaust Cleaning | $150 – $250 |
Dryer Vent Repair or Replacement | $150 – $300 |
Disclaimer: Prices are approximate and vary depending on the company, location, and condition of your ducts or vents. Always check with local service providers near you.
FAQs
Q1: How often should I schedule dryer vent cleaning?
At least once a year. If you use your dryer often or live in a house with long ductwork, you may need cleaning more frequently.
Q2: Can I improve airflow with DIY tools?
DIY kits with brushes and hose attachments can help for maintenance, but they do not unclog deep ductwork. Professional cleaners provide thorough results.
Q3: Will dryer vent cleaning affect my HVAC or AC system?
Yes. Better airflow in dryer ducts supports overall household ventilation, reducing strain on HVAC and AC systems.
Q4: How do I know if poor airflow is caused by the dryer vent?
Signs include longer drying times, overheating machines, lint buildup near the trap or outside vent, and unusual odors.

How Often Should Homeowners Check Dryer Vent Airflow?
Homeowners should regularly check for airflow issues by monitoring laundry cycles, inspecting the outside vent for strong air output, and cleaning the lint trap after every load. If airflow seems weak, it’s time to call a professional cleaner. Consistent checks help keep ducts unclogged and ensure long-term ventilation efficiency.
